Greetings, so the question is, how much characters you need for a normally working village and what their stat/role setup should be?

In old Haven I had:
Miner/Fighter/Hunter "main"
Farmer/Tailor/Dex alt
Carpentry/Surv alt (no stats needed, just skills)
Exploration/Hunter alt

That was enough for most tasks. What's it like in the current game?

I suggest to have mining alt, hunting alt, laboring alt (for chopping trees etc), farmer alt, crafting alt or two that never exit walls, fighter alt if thats your thing, foragers are pretty much useless these days but I'd say one alt with decent exp and surv is good for tracking atleast.
